House for sale near Vidin

This is a nice and well maintained rural house located in the beautiful fishing area of Vidin. The property lies in a picturesque small village 19 km away from Vidin city and less than 150 km far from the bank of the river Danube. The hamlet has approximately 65 permanent residents and it's quiet and peaceful.

The house is pretty and doesn't need any repairs or additional investments. It has about 80 sq m living area distributed between 4 rooms and a cellar. The rooms are upstairs and the cellar is on the ground floor. Water and electricity are available in the house.

The garden of the property is 1000 sq m planted with fruit trees. There are no additional structures in the yard but enough space for building a swimming pool and barbecue area. The property has very good location with lovely forest view. Furthermore the big river Danube is within walking distance from the property and there are excellent conditions for fishing and boating.
